Mannotriose regulates learning and memory signal transduction in the hippocampus

摘      要:Rehmannia is a commonly used Chinese herb, which improves ieaming and memory. However, the crucial components of the signal transduction pathway associated with this effect remain elusive. Pri- mary hippocampal neurons were cultured in vitro, insulted with high-concentration (1 × 10-4 mol/L) cor- ticosterone, and treated with 1 × 104 mol/L mannotriose. Thiazolyl blue tetrazolium bromide assay and western blot analysis showed that hippocampal neuron survival rates and protein levels of glucocorti- cold receptor, serum and glucocorticoid-regulated protein kinase, and brain-derived neurotrophic factor were all dramatically decreased after high-concentration corticosterone-induced injury. This effect was reversed by mannotriose, to a similar level as RU38486 and donepezil. Our findings indicate that mannotriose could protect hippocampal neurons from high-concentration corticosterone-induced injury. The mechanism by which this occurred was associated with levels of glucocorticoid receptor protein, serum and glucocorticoid-regulated protein kinase, and brain-derived neurotrophic factor.
